As Chief Information Officer, Thomas Licciardello leads all aspects of the technology department for the New York eHealth Collaborative (NYeC). He is responsible for the infrastructure, operations, and development and provides the technical vision and strategy to continuously drive and enhance technology products and services. He also serves on the senior leadership team of the organization, collaborating cross-functionally to ensure innovation, security, compliance, policy, and financial stability to drive and support the mission of the organization.
Thomas Licciardello brings 20+ years of solid and progressive enterprise-level experience building world-class technology products and services. He has been recognized for partnering with business teams and executives and building high-performing teams to align on organizational priorities and transform technology to move organizations forward. He has experience as Lead Systems Engineer for AIG, Director of Information Technology at XpresSpa, Vice President, Infrastructure and Operations at Teach For America, and Vice President, Information Technology, Infrastructure, and Security at WebMD. Thomas has a Bachelor of Science in Computer Science from Pace University. He also holds a Master of Science in Executive Technology Management from Columbia University. He has multiple technical certifications from Microsoft, ITIL, CompTIA, the Gartner Leadership Academy, and more.
